summaryrefslogtreecommitdiff
path: root/perl.h
diff options
context:
space:
mode:
authorJohn E. Malmberg <wb8tyw@qsl.net>2005-10-25 09:36:20 -0400
committerRafael Garcia-Suarez <rgarciasuarez@gmail.com>2005-10-26 08:58:42 +0000
commit52e64fc8b5379b483536e0f6eb064825c7a9f6a5 (patch)
tree450f25868a02e974e9b7932f5dfd19c9a48f040f /perl.h
parentca0c25f67f45e5dccb746852d8545d7ae29ed067 (diff)
downloadperl-52e64fc8b5379b483536e0f6eb064825c7a9f6a5.tar.gz
Re: [patch@25838]Hopefully the last VMS exit/error fixes needed.
From: "John E. Malmberg" <wb8tyw@qsl.net> Message-ID: <435E6D14.7000104@qsl.net> p4raw-id: //depot/perl@25851
Diffstat (limited to 'perl.h')
-rw-r--r--perl.h4
1 files changed, 2 insertions, 2 deletions
diff --git a/perl.h b/perl.h
index d302252ec1..97e805843f 100644
--- a/perl.h
+++ b/perl.h
@@ -2691,7 +2691,7 @@ typedef pthread_key_t perl_key;
if (MY_POSIX_EXIT) \
PL_statusvalue_vms = \
(C_FAC_POSIX | (evalue << 3 ) | (evalue == 1)? \
- (STS$K_ERROR | STS$M_INHIB_MSG) : 0); \
+ (STS$K_ERROR | STS$M_INHIB_MSG) : 1); \
else \
PL_statusvalue_vms = SS$_ABORT; \
} else { /* forgive them Perl, for they have sinned */ \
@@ -2726,7 +2726,7 @@ typedef pthread_key_t perl_key;
if (MY_POSIX_EXIT) \
PL_statusvalue_vms = \
(C_FAC_POSIX | (evalue << 3 ) | (evalue == 1)? \
- (STS$K_ERROR | STS$M_INHIB_MSG) : 0); \
+ (STS$K_ERROR | STS$M_INHIB_MSG) : 1); \
else \
PL_statusvalue_vms = evalue ? evalue : SS$_NORMAL; \
set_vaxc_errno(PL_statusvalue_vms); \